Physics Graduate Students Receive Recognition for Breakthrough Technology for Particle Accelerators
March 24, 2016Physics graduate students Mattia Checchin and Martina Martinello have been working at nearby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ory (FNAL) on a breakthrough technology for particle accelerators using superconducting radiofrequency (SRF) cavities. -
